- None of us here know exactly what the future of the space launch industry will
- be. Making blanket statements about the future is an extremely hazardous
- business: the only certainly is that the probability of being wrong is high.
-
- SSTO might work; it might not. After a test program that truly demonstrates
- the key technologies, we may know whether the SSTO
- concept is viable. The question is: do you support a SSTO test
- program, or do you believe the concept is so flawed that it is
- pointless to test the technologies?
